40 /*
41 * This the the zoom2, board specific, gpmc configuration for the
42 * quad uart on the debug board. The more general gpmc configurations
43 * are setup at the cpu level in cpu/arm_cortexa8/omap3/mem.c
44 *
45 * The details of the setting of the serial gpmc setup are not available.
46 * The values were provided by another party.
47 */
48 extern void enable_gpmc_config(u32 *gpmc_config, gpmc_csx_t *gpmc_cs_base,
49 u32 base, u32 size);
50
51 static u32 gpmc_serial_TL16CP754C[GPMC_MAX_REG] = {
52 0x00011000,
53 0x001F1F01,
54 0x00080803,
55 0x1D091D09,
56 0x041D1F1F,
57 0x1D0904C4, 0
58 };

60 /*
61 * Routine: board_init
62 * Description: Early hardware init.
63 */
64 int board_init (void)
65 {
66 DECLARE_GLOBAL_DATA_PTR;
67 gpmc_csx_t *serial_cs_base;
68 u32 *gpmc_config;
69
70 gpmc_init (); /* in SRAM or SDRAM, finish GPMC */
71
72 /* Configure console support on zoom2 */
73 gpmc_config = gpmc_serial_TL16CP754C;
74 serial_cs_base = (gpmc_csx_t *) (GPMC_CONFIG_CS0_BASE +
75 (3 * GPMC_CONFIG_WIDTH));
76 enable_gpmc_config(gpmc_config,
77 serial_cs_base,
78 SERIAL_TL16CP754C_BASE,
79 GPMC_SIZE_16M);
80
81 /* board id for Linux */
82 gd->bd->bi_arch_number = MACH_TYPE_OMAP_ZOOM2;
83 /* boot param addr */
84 gd->bd->bi_boot_params = (OMAP34XX_SDRC_CS0 + 0x100);
85
86 #if defined(CONFIG_STATUS_LED) && defined(STATUS_LED_BOOT)
87 status_led_set (STATUS_LED_BOOT, STATUS_LED_ON);
88 #endif
89
90 return 0;
91 }
